66 int
67 procfs_doprocstatus(PFS_FILL_ARGS)
68 {
69 	struct session *sess;
70 	struct thread *tdfirst;
71 	struct tty *tp;
72 	struct ucred *cr;
73 	char *pc;
74 	char *sep;
75 	int pid, ppid, pgid, sid;
76 	int i;
77 
78 	pid = p->p_pid;
79 	PROC_LOCK(p);
80 	ppid = p->p_pptr ? p->p_pptr->p_pid : 0;
81 	pgid = p->p_pgrp->pg_id;
82 	sess = p->p_pgrp->pg_session;
83 	SESS_LOCK(sess);
84 	sid = sess->s_leader ? sess->s_leader->p_pid : 0;
85 
86 /* comm pid ppid pgid sid maj,min ctty,sldr start ut st wmsg
87                                 euid ruid rgid,egid,groups[1 .. NGROUPS]
88 */
89 
90 	pc = p->p_comm;
91 	do {
92 		if (*pc < 33 || *pc > 126 || *pc == '\\')
93 			sbuf_printf(sb, "\\%03o", *pc);
94 		else
95 			sbuf_putc(sb, *pc);
96 	} while (*++pc);
97 	sbuf_printf(sb, " %d %d %d %d ", pid, ppid, pgid, sid);
98 	if ((p->p_flag&P_CONTROLT) && (tp = sess->s_ttyp))
99 		sbuf_printf(sb, "%d,%d ", major(tp->t_dev), minor(tp->t_dev));
100 	else
101 		sbuf_printf(sb, "%d,%d ", -1, -1);
102 
103 	sep = "";
104 	if (sess->s_ttyvp) {
105 		sbuf_printf(sb, "%sctty", sep);
106 		sep = ",";
107 	}
108 	if (SESS_LEADER(p)) {
109 		sbuf_printf(sb, "%ssldr", sep);
110 		sep = ",";
111 	}
112 	SESS_UNLOCK(sess);
113 	if (*sep != ',') {
114 		sbuf_printf(sb, "noflags");
115 	}
116 
117 	mtx_lock_spin(&sched_lock);
118 	if (p->p_sflag & PS_INMEM) {
119 		struct timeval ut, st;
120 
121 		calcru(p, &ut, &st, (struct timeval *) NULL);
122 		mtx_unlock_spin(&sched_lock);
123 		sbuf_printf(sb, " %lld,%ld %ld,%ld %ld,%ld",
124 		    (long long)p->p_stats->p_start.tv_sec,
125 		    p->p_stats->p_start.tv_usec,
126 		    ut.tv_sec, ut.tv_usec,
127 		    st.tv_sec, st.tv_usec);
128 	} else {
129 		mtx_unlock_spin(&sched_lock);
130 		sbuf_printf(sb, " -1,-1 -1,-1 -1,-1");
131 	}
132 
133 	if (p->p_flag & P_THREADED)
134 		sbuf_printf(sb, " %s", "-kse- ");
135 	else {
136 		tdfirst = FIRST_THREAD_IN_PROC(p);	/* XXX diff from td? */
137 		sbuf_printf(sb, " %s",
138 		    (tdfirst->td_wchan && tdfirst->td_wmesg) ?
139 		    tdfirst->td_wmesg : "nochan");
140 	}
141 
142 	cr = p->p_ucred;
143 
144 	sbuf_printf(sb, " %lu %lu %lu",
145 		(u_long)cr->cr_uid,
146 		(u_long)cr->cr_ruid,
147 		(u_long)cr->cr_rgid);
148 
149 	/* egid (cr->cr_svgid) is equal to cr_ngroups[0]
150 	   see also getegid(2) in /sys/kern/kern_prot.c */
151 
152 	for (i = 0; i < cr->cr_ngroups; i++) {
153 		sbuf_printf(sb, ",%lu", (u_long)cr->cr_groups[i]);
154 	}
155 
156 	if (jailed(p->p_ucred)) {
157 		mtx_lock(&p->p_ucred->cr_prison->pr_mtx);
158 		sbuf_printf(sb, " %s", p->p_ucred->cr_prison->pr_host);
159 		mtx_unlock(&p->p_ucred->cr_prison->pr_mtx);
160 	} else {
161 		sbuf_printf(sb, " -");
162 	}
163 	PROC_UNLOCK(p);
164 	sbuf_printf(sb, "\n");
165 
166 	return (0);
167 }

169 int
170 procfs_doproccmdline(PFS_FILL_ARGS)
171 {
172 	struct ps_strings pstr;
173 	int error, i;
174 
175 	/*
176 	 * If we are using the ps/cmdline caching, use that.  Otherwise
177 	 * revert back to the old way which only implements full cmdline
178 	 * for the currept process and just p->p_comm for all other
179 	 * processes.
180 	 * Note that if the argv is no longer available, we deliberately
181 	 * don't fall back on p->p_comm or return an error: the authentic
182 	 * Linux behaviour is to return zero-length in this case.
183 	 */
184 
185 	PROC_LOCK(p);
186 	if (p->p_args && (ps_argsopen || !p_cansee(td, p))) {
187 		sbuf_bcpy(sb, p->p_args->ar_args, p->p_args->ar_length);
188 		PROC_UNLOCK(p);
189 		return (0);
190 	}
191 	PROC_UNLOCK(p);
192 	if (p != td->td_proc) {
193 		sbuf_printf(sb, "%.*s", MAXCOMLEN, p->p_comm);
194 	} else {
195 		error = copyin((void *)p->p_sysent->sv_psstrings, &pstr,
196 		    sizeof(pstr));
197 		if (error)
198 			return (error);
199 		for (i = 0; i < pstr.ps_nargvstr; i++) {
200 			sbuf_copyin(sb, pstr.ps_argvstr[i], 0);
201 			sbuf_printf(sb, "%c", '\0');
202 		}
203 	}
204 
205 	return (0);
206 }
